A leading plumbing services provider in the UK is seeking a Plumber to maintain and repair plumbing systems and central heating in client properties. The ideal candidate must possess NVQ Level 2 in plumbing and have experience in social housing. This permanent position offers a salary range of £32,500 to £37,500 plus overtime and a fuel card.
Responsibilities include:
- Conducting repairs
- Managing job documentation efficiently
- Liaising with clients
This role comes with opportunities for professional growth and a supportive workplace environment.
